Editor's Notes

  • #3 Current Activities This slide focuses on the acquisition projects. We are undertaking these projects as: - We have an ageing membership – average age is 57 and rising and we need to bring this down for the long term survival of the Institution. - We attained our EngTech license and want to expand this level of membership, taking advantage of the possible 500,000 technicians available in the community. - We wish to ensure all past lapse members have the opportunity to be a member of the Institution and reach their maximum potential. - Offer people in the Armed Forces with an Institution which understands their particular needs.   • #10 Why are we here? – Engineers promoting to the next generation The number one issue for the members in the corporate survey has been engagement with schools and spreading the message of engineering to the next generation. They wish us to provide activities, educational information and support for teachers. They also have a desire for IMechE to intervene at a lower age, even if it is general engineering promotion (not specifically mechanical) Greenpower Greenpower offers students at primary and secondary schools an opportunity to design, build and race an electric car. The event has 22 regional heats with over 400 teams now competing. IMechE provides funding, marketing, advice and helpers for the event. It is also becoming one of the major activities for many of the Regional Committees. Big Bang A joint Institutional project to create the UK ’s largest science, engineering and math fair. Launched in 2008, the event attracted 6500 students as well as a host of companies and personalities. It was Colin who originally came up with the idea before the running was passed to ETB. Formula Student Our flagship event aimed at providing students with practical challenge of designing, building and driving a single seater car. This year we have 105 teams for 20 countries competing at Silverstone. With luck, FS will be the largest event of this type in the world – even surpassing the SAE event in the USA. The event is a key selling point to universities and students, often with oversubscription to FS focussed courses. Publications We produce a number of publications under the new Engeneration brand, helping students and teachers with practical information, advice and facts on engineering. Engeneration also looks after ‘Engineering your Future’ – an event run by the Regions to give students real life engineering examples from participating companies.

  • #13 Intellectual Leadership This slide demonstrates the work being undertaken to get our messages out to media and government etc. The reports offer a good medium for the Institution to create its own stories and rely less on reactive press/comment. Upcoming reports: Geo-engineering. A report to outline the value geo-engineering has in helping fight climate change. It is not a solution but could give us some breathing space. This report is also in response to Joan Ruddock MP stating geo-engineering was not even on the Government ’s radar. MAG – Mitigation, Adaptation and Geo-engineering. This report coincides with COP 15 which will replace Kyoto. On this subject, a new Fellow from last year, Alison Cooke , is helping us develop the Institution ’s submission to Copenhagen with other IMechE members. In addition, Alison volunteered to contact other Fellows to find out where, when and how they can help the Institution on a wide range of projects as and when they arise. Engineering Diploma – A report card after two years of the new engineering diploma running in schools. It will focus on the curriculum, teacher assistance and student perceptions of the Diploma. The report will be fashioned like a report card. Future of Flight – To be launched alongside Farnborough and looks at the future developments in the aerospace industry and the possible direction aeroplanes will take in the next 20-30 years. Nuclear – A report on what is needed for the development of a new set of nuclear power stations. Some focus will be on skills as well as the economic benefits this industry has/has not for the UK.
  • #14 Intellectual Leadership Position Statements were created to provide concise information for MPs and Peers. Launched in February this year, the statements cover all four themes and provide readers with the Institution ’s views on a wide range of subjects. We have already created over 24 position statements and will continue over the next few years to add additional papers and update existing statements.
